Cornish, UT and Paragonah, UT have a very similar cost of living, with only a 4.2% difference in their overall index. Cornish scores 86 while Paragonah scores 89 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.

On the housing front, median rent in Cornish is $1,000/month compared to $1,089/month in Paragonah — a 8%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Cornish is more affordable at $276,200 median vs $279,200.

Median household income in Cornish is $87,500 compared to $70,057 in Paragonah (+24.9%). Cornish off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Cornish spend roughly 13.7% of their income on rent, less than the 18.7% in Paragonah.
